    It talks about the types of risks that anyone can face in his life. The objective is to identify them, sort them out and prioritize what is the most likely to happen in your own life. If you life in Alaska I doubt that a wild fire will be a huge concern, especially in winter. If you live in the desert of Arizona, a flood should be the least of your problems.

    I am not going into the realm of alien invasions, big apocalyptic asteroids…As you need to believe in them first, and they are unlikely the impact would be greater than a single person could handle. It goes beyond prepping. First go for the realistic stuff, then when you will be confortable maybe going for the “fun / mysterious / crazy” kinda thing.

    Plan accordingly, you cannot be prepared for everything but you can focus on the top 3 or the first 2 most likely events or disasters that can affect you. Also many “trivial” and most likely events can occur. Losing a job, having a relative that passes away, being sick for 1 or 2 weeks unable to work or do much at home : Those are also things you can prepare for.

    Sometimes prepping for events can overlap and that’s good : Less work to do to cover several events. Example : A nuclear disaster can overlap with bacteria or virus contaminations (some of the equipment, procedures…)
